What is Private Psychiatry?
Private psychiatry describes psychiatric services supplied by mental health specialists in a non-public setting. These services are generally funded by clients through direct payment or private insurance coverage, permitting for higher versatility and personalization in treatment.
Key Features of Private PsychiatryPersonalized Care: Patients frequently have more control over their treatment options, consisting of frequency of sessions, treatment methods, and the choice of companies.Extended Appointments: Private specialists typically have the ability to assign more time for each session, allowing a much deeper expedition of issues.Decreased Wait Times: Compared to civil services, private psychiatry usually has shorter wait times for consultations.Ingenious Treatments: Many private practitioners adopt newer healing techniques and medications that might not yet be extensively readily available in civil services.Benefits of Private PsychiatryBoosted Access to Services
Private psychiatry can use instant access to mental health professionals. This is especially important for individuals handling urgent mental health problems who can not pay for the prolonged waiting times often associated with public services.
Greater Choice of Specialists
Patients have the flexibility to select from a series of professionals, consisting of psychiatrists, psychologists, and psychotherapists. This permits them to find a company whose approach lines up with their values and needs.
Continuity of Care
Consistency in treatment is important for healing. Private psychiatry assists in continuity of care by enabling clients to see the exact same practitioner with time, fostering a relying on healing relationship.
Confidentiality and Comfort
Numerous individuals prefer the personal privacy associated with private care. The therapeutic space frequently feels more safe and can minimize preconception surrounding mental health treatment.
Comprehensive Treatment Options
Private specialists tend to provide a more comprehensive series of treatments, including psychopharmacological treatments, psychiatric therapy modalities, and alternative therapies.
Challenges in Private Psychiatry
Despite its advantages, private psychiatry is not without difficulties:
Financial Considerations
While private services can provide instant and customized care, they can likewise be excessively costly. Without insurance coverage, lots of patients might have a hard time to afford continuous treatment.
Variable Quality of Services
The private sector is not regulated in the exact same method as civil services, which can lead to inconsistency in the quality and requirement of care. Patients need to perform comprehensive research study before dedicating to treatment.
Restricted Availability of Specialists
While numerous experts exist within the private sector, particular areas may not have sufficient coverage. Clients in rural areas might deal with minimal options.
Insurance Limitations
Not all private psychiatrists accept insurance coverage, and those that do might have constraints associated with treatment types or length, potentially complicating patients' access to the care they need.

Q2: Is private psychiatry covered by insurance coverage?
A: Many private psychiatrists accept insurance, but it is crucial to verify protection and any prospective out-of-pocket costs prior to your very first appointment.
Q3: How much does private psychiatric treatment cost?
A: Costs can differ considerably, frequently ranging from ₤ 100 to ₤ 500 per session, depending upon the company's credentials and the region's cost of living.
Q4: Can I see a private psychiatrist without a referral?
A: Yes, a lot of private psychiatrists permit you to self-refer, though some insurance coverage companies might need a recommendation.
Q5: How long does treatment generally last?
A: The period of treatment differs for everybody based upon particular needs and development. Some might need only a couple of sessions, while others might participate in long-lasting treatment.
